Great little cafe in Pauatahanui. Decent food, friendly staff and good availability for seating and parking.<br/>Although their food is quite pricey it is quite tasty. Sausage Roll from the cabinet and Nachos are always my go to when I visit.<br/>Coffee from here is also really good.<br/>Ground Up does get quite busy on weekends especially between 10am - Midday after kids sport and they don't do bookings so if you are coming with a group you could take your chance but may pay to go somewhere else. Also does take a while for your food and coffee to arrive when they are busy.<br/>Still a good little local cafe to visit.<br/><br/>Food - 8/10<br/>Coffee - 8/10<br/>Friendliness - 7/10<br/>Cleanliness - 6/10<br/>Price - 6/10<br/><br/>Would I return - Yes

Facing a busy road is groundup cafe. There are basically 3 areas for seating: indoor, alfresco or seats facing the road. They have ample car park lots behind it too! <br/>Foodwise: By the time we arrived, kitchen was closed so we were only limited to choices in the cabinet. It was a huge variety and everything looks great! I also appreciate it when crews recommend whats good as opposed to "everything's good!" IKR. So anyway, we chose a bacon spinach pastry and a croissant loaded with bacon, egg and veg coupled with a warm mocha and latte. Guess what? Everything hit the spot. Special shoutout to the barista who made our awesome coffee and the very friendly Max. No reason not to visit when it's so near my place :) Highly recommended!
